Hannah Moore, M.S., OTR/L

Occupational Therapist

Hannah Moore, MS, OTR/L is an occupational therapist at ACCESS since 2017. Initially, Hannah split her time between both the Early Childhood and Academy campuses, but has been full time at the Academy campus since March 2018. Hannah is the main occupational therapist assigned to the Intermediate 1 classroom. She has extensive continuing education training in the areas of sensory processing, dyslexia, dysgraphia, and executive functioning. She has been trained in the Zones of Regulation framework and has assisted in educating staff and implementing this program in multiple classrooms at the Academy.

Having a background in special education has been incredibly valuable to Hannah as an OT at ACCESS. Being a part of the team that empowers each student to succeed not only in the classroom but also at home and in the community is a true honor and joy for Hannah. She loves how much FUN she and her students have together!

She holds a Bachelor of Science in Special Education from Mississippi State University--go dawgs! Hannah then went on to earn her Masters of Occupational Therapy in 2017 from the University of Tennessee Health Science Center in Memphis, Tennessee. She moved to Little Rock immediately following graduation to work at ACCESS.
